The Russian authorities were warning yesterday to contaminate the beaches in the popular spa town of the Black Sea, in view of the summer tourist season, due to the oil spill caused by the wreckage of two oil tankers in December. The Russian Health Service Rospotrebnadzor has found “non -compliance with the rules of public health and hygiene of sand and sea water samples” in the Raps and other areas of the Krasnandar Region (southwest), which attracts many summer holidaymakers. This recommendation can have serious consequences for the revolt, which has received a growing number of tourists in recent years, as citizens of the Russian Federation continue to face travel restrictions on the European Union after the outbreak of the war in Ukraine, with the invasion of the Russian armed forces. This spa town welcomed some 5.5 million visitors in 2024.
